My wife and I attended the Goodwood Revival a month ago. Simply amazing. There is no good way to describe it. Just go.

Every car was magnificent. There were five Cobras. I got their pictures in the paddock but when I tried to upload them the system said they were too big to upload. Per the program they were...

Entrant..............Drivers...................... ..................Year
Peter Raumann.....Johannes Offergeld/Barrie Williams.....1963
Conrad Ulrich.......Conrad Ulrich/ Brian Redman.............1964
Erica Austin.........Rob Hall/ T.B.A..............................1962
Ludovic Caron......Ludovic Caron/ Darron Turner...........1963
Bill Bridges...........Bill Bridges/ David Franklin...............1963

I went in my Kirkham and was able to park in the pre-'66 car park. I really is an excellent event.
It is almost worth going just to look around the car park. Some of the highlights included a couple of 4½ "Blower" Bentleys, 275 GTB/4 and 250 GT Lusso Ferraris, DB4 GT Zagato Aston, my Kirkham.
Seriously though, a number of people came up to me and were thrilled to see an "actual" Kirkham. They seemed more excited than if it was a genuine Cobra. I wonder if we'll ever get to the point of having replica Kirkhams.

If you get the opportunity to go to the Goodwood Revival, don't let it pass by. You won't regret it. I would also strongly recommend that you go dressed in period attire.
